El componente de <Icon />
tambien acepta la propiedad solid
. Podemos usar esta propiedad para cambiar el estilo del corazón. Quedaría algo como esto:
Sistema de formularios
Descarga el código base del proyecto
Pantalla de Mi cuenta
Formulario de Login
Sistema de formularios avanzados
Implementando Formik y Yup
Iniciando sesión
useAuth: manejo de sesiones con Custom Hooks y React Context
Datos del usuario y logout
Sistema de favoritos
Botón de añadir a favoritos
Almacenando un Pokémon favorito con AsyncStorage
Almacenando varios Pokémon favoritos
Pantalla de favoritos
Toggle en el botón de favoritos
Eliminar Pokémon de favoritos
Lista de Pokémon favoritos
Navegación hacia atrás en favoritos
Logout
Sincronizando información entre pantallas
Pre deploy
Configuración básica antes del BUILD
Cómo generar el APK y AAB para Android
Cómo generar la app para iOS
¿Quieres cursos más avanzados de React Native?
Aún no tienes acceso a esta clase
Crea una cuenta y continúa viendo este curso
Aportes 4
Preguntas 0
El componente de <Icon />
tambien acepta la propiedad solid
. Podemos usar esta propiedad para cambiar el estilo del corazón. Quedaría algo como esto:
Hasta ahora para lo que utilizamos lodash, son cosas ya nativas en JS (Array.prototype.includes()) y en CSS (textTransform: ‘capitalize’).
Por lo que includes se puede usar sobre el array response:
response.includes(id)
Si alguien tiene problemas para con el boton de favortios en Android es porque el “AsyncStorage” esta deprecado y la forma en la que lo estamos importando no es la correcta.
Esta es la forma correcta:
import AsyncStorage from '@react-native-community/async-storage'
Si no les funciona chekeen haber escrito bien ‘includes’
¿Quieres ver más aportes, preguntas y respuestas de la comunidad? Crea una cuenta o inicia sesión.